VBScript, short for Visual Basic Scripting Edition, is a scripting language from Microsoft that’s been around since 1996. Think of it as a lighter, interpreted version of Visual Basic, designed to run directly on Windows. For years, system administrators and developers leaned on VBScript to automate all sorts of mundane tasks on their computers, like managing files, interacting with applications, or even adding dynamic features to web pages though mostly just for Internet Explorer back in the day. It came pre-installed on every Windows desktop since Windows 98, so it was pretty accessible.

Now, it’s true that VBScript is considered a “deprecated” language by Microsoft, meaning they’re not actively developing it further and are recommending newer alternatives like PowerShell and JavaScript. Getting Started: Creating Your First VBScript File

Creating a VBScript file is surprisingly simple. You don’t need any fancy software. a basic text editor like Notepad is all you need to start.

What You Need

  • A Text Editor: Notepad built into Windows, Notepad++, Visual Studio Code, or any other plain text editor will do the trick.
  • Your Brain and maybe some coffee: For writing the actual code!

Your First VBScript: The “Hello World” Example

Every programmer starts with “Hello World,” and VBScript is no different. This little script will simply pop up a message box on your screen.

  1. Open your Text Editor: Go ahead and open Notepad.

  2. Type the code: Copy and paste the following line into your blank Notepad document:

    MsgBox "Hello, World! This is my first VBScript."
    

    That’s it! MsgBox is a built-in VBScript function that displays a message box with the text you provide. The Ultimate Guide to the Best Blenders for Amazing Blended Drinks

  3. Save the file: This is the crucial part.

    • Go to File > Save As...
    • In the “Save As” dialog, navigate to a folder where you want to keep your script e.g., your Desktop or a new folder called “My VBScripts”.
    • For “File name,” type something descriptive like HelloWorld.vbs. The .vbs extension is super importantβ€”it tells Windows that this is a VBScript file.
    • For “Save as type,” select “All Files *.*“. If you leave it as “Text Documents *.txt“, your file will be saved as HelloWorld.vbs.txt, and Windows won’t recognize it as a script.
    • Click Save.

Congratulations! You’ve just created your first VBScript file.

Running VBScript Files

Now that you have a VBScript file, how do you actually make it do something? There are a few ways, each with its own quirks.

1. Double-Clicking the File

The easiest way to run a VBScript is simply to double-click its .vbs file in File Explorer. Windows will automatically use the default VBScript host WScript.exe to execute it. Navigating VPNs with Starlink for WGU Students: A Comprehensive Guide

  • Pros: Super quick and easy.
  • Cons: If your script has errors or runs silently, you might not know what happened. Output from WScript.Echo will appear in separate message boxes, which can be annoying for lengthy outputs.

2. Running from Command Prompt CMD

Running scripts from the Command Prompt gives you more control, especially for scripts that generate text output or need specific arguments. You’ll typically use cscript.exe for this.

  1. Open Command Prompt: Press Windows Key + R, type cmd, and hit Enter. Or search for “Command Prompt” in the Start menu.

  2. Navigate to your script’s directory: Use the cd command. For example, if your HelloWorld.vbs is on your Desktop, you’d type:

    cd C:\Users\YourUsername\Desktop
    Replace `YourUsername` with your actual Windows username.
    
  3. Execute the script using cscript: Type cscript HelloWorld.vbs and press Enter.

    You’ll see the “Hello, World!” message printed directly in the Command Prompt window, not in a separate pop-up message box. This is one of the key differences between wscript and cscript. How to Generate Voice: Your Ultimate Guide to AI Voice Generation (and Sounding Like a Pro!)

    Self-Correction: If you just type HelloWorld.vbs without cscript or wscript, Windows will use the default host, which is usually wscript.exe, giving you a message box. Using cscript explicitly forces console output.

3. Running from PowerShell

PowerShell is a more modern and powerful command-line shell than the traditional Command Prompt, but you can still run VBScripts in it.

  1. Open PowerShell: Search for “PowerShell” in the Start menu.
  2. Navigate to your script’s directory: Similar to CMD, use cd.
  3. Execute the script: Type cscript .\HelloWorld.vbs and press Enter. The .\ dot-backslash is often needed in PowerShell to indicate that you’re running an executable in the current directory.

4. Executing with Administrator Rights

Sometimes, your VBScript might need to perform actions that require elevated permissions, like modifying system files or registry entries. In such cases, you’ll need to run it as an administrator.

  • For double-clicking: You can’t directly “Run as administrator” by double-clicking a .vbs file. You’d typically need a shortcut or a batch file that then calls the VBScript with admin rights.
  • From Command Prompt/PowerShell:
    1. Search for “Command Prompt” or “PowerShell” in the Start menu.
    2. Right-click on it and select “Run as administrator.”
    3. Navigate to your script’s directory and execute it using cscript as described above.

Understanding WScript and CScript

As you’ve seen, WScript.exe and CScript.exe are both Windows Script Host WSH executables that run VBScripts and other scripting languages like JScript. They are almost identical under the hood, but they handle input/output differently. The Cheapest Way to Zanzibar: Your Ultimate Budget Travel Guide

  • WScript.exe Windows-based Script Host:

    • This is the default host when you double-click a .vbs file.
    • It’s designed for scripts that primarily interact with a graphical user interface GUI.
    • Any WScript.Echo commands in your script will display their output in separate message boxes.
    • It doesn’t open a console window by default.
  • CScript.exe Command-line Script Host:

    • This host is perfect for scripts that you want to run from the command line or in a batch file.
    • It directs WScript.Echo output directly to the console window where the script is run.
    • It creates a console window by default if the parent process doesn’t have one.

When to use which:

  • Use WScript when your script needs to show pop-up messages or interact with graphical elements, and you want it to run without a command window.
  • Use CScript when you want your script’s output to appear in the command line, especially for scripts that automate tasks or process data without much user interaction. It’s often preferred for debugging, too.

You can also set the default script host. If you double-click a .vbs file and it opens with the “Open with…” dialog, you can choose cscript.exe or wscript.exe and check “Always use this program to open this file type” to set a default.

VBScript in Action: Practical Examples

Let’s look at a couple of slightly more involved examples to show you what VBScript can do.

Example 1: Creating a Folder and Writing a File

This script will create a new folder on your desktop and then write some text into a new file inside that folder.

' This is a single-line comment. Everything after the apostrophe is ignored.
' We'll create a folder and then a file inside it.

' Create a FileSystemObject to interact with files and folders
Set objFSO = CreateObject"Scripting.FileSystemObject"

' Get the path to the user's desktop
strDesktop = objFSO.GetSpecialFolder0 ' 0 represents the Windows Desktop folder

' Define the new folder name
strFolderName = "MyVBScriptFolder"
strFolderPath = strDesktop & "\" & strFolderName

' Check if the folder already exists. If not, create it.
If Not objFSO.FolderExistsstrFolderPath Then
    objFSO.CreateFolder strFolderPath
    MsgBox "Folder '" & strFolderName & "' created on desktop."
Else
    MsgBox "Folder '" & strFolderName & "' already exists."
End If

' Define the file name and path
strFileName = "MyLog.txt"
strFilePath = strFolderPath & "\" & strFileName

' Open the file for writing True means overwrite if exists, False means append
' For appending, use OpenTextFilestrFilePath, 8, True
Set objFile = objFSO.CreateTextFilestrFilePath, True

' Write some lines to the file
objFile.WriteLine "This is the first line written by VBScript."
objFile.WriteLine "Another line of text here."
objFile.WriteLine "The current date and time is: " & Now

' Close the file
objFile.Close

MsgBox "Text written to '" & strFileName & "' in '" & strFolderName & "'."

' Clean up objects good practice
Set objFile = Nothing
Set objFSO = Nothing

Save this as CreateAndWrite.vbs and try running it. You’ll see messages confirming the folder and file creation. Then, check your desktop for the new folder and open MyLog.txt to see the content.

VBScript with Excel: Automating Spreadsheets

You might be wondering if VBScript can work with Excel, similar to VBA Visual Basic for Applications. The answer is yes, but there’s an important distinction.

VBA Visual Basic for Applications is the programming language built directly into Microsoft Office applications like Excel, Word, and Access. When you write macros inside an Excel workbook, you’re using VBA. These macros are stored within the workbook itself. How to Snag the Cheapest Ticket from Manila to Zamboanga: Your Ultimate Guide!

VBScript, on the other hand, is a standalone scripting language that runs on Windows. It can control Excel and other COM-enabled applications from outside the application. You write a .vbs file, and that file then creates an instance of Excel and manipulates it.

Why use VBScript for Excel instead of VBA?

  • External Control: You might need to automate Excel from a batch file, a scheduled task, or another external process without opening Excel manually.
  • Simplicity for One-Off Tasks: For very simple automation, a VBScript can sometimes feel quicker to write and deploy than setting up a full VBA module within Excel.

How an External VBScript Can Interact with Excel

Here’s a simple example of a VBScript that opens an Excel workbook, adds some data, and saves it.

‘ This script will open Excel, add data to a sheet, and save the workbook.

‘ Create an Excel Application object
Set objExcel = CreateObject”Excel.Application”
objExcel.Visible = True ‘ Set to True to see Excel open, False to run in background

‘ Create a new workbook
Set objWorkbook = objExcel.Workbooks.Add Cheapest bus ticket from new york to washington dc

‘ Get the first worksheet
Set objSheet = objWorkbook.Sheets1

‘ Add some data to cells
objSheet.Cells1, 1.Value = “Name”
objSheet.Cells1, 2.Value = “Score”
objSheet.Cells2, 1.Value = “Alice”
objSheet.Cells2, 2.Value = 95
objSheet.Cells3, 1.Value = “Bob”
objSheet.Cells3, 2.Value = 88

‘ AutoFit columns for better readability
objSheet.Columns”A:B”.AutoFit

‘ Define a path to save the workbook
strSavePath = “C:\Users\YourUsername\Desktop\VBScript_Excel_Report.xlsx” ‘ Change YourUsername and path as needed!

‘ Save the workbook
objWorkbook.SaveAs strSavePath Your Guide to Getting from King William’s Town to East London: Smooth Journeys and What to Expect!

‘ Close the workbook
objWorkbook.Close

‘ Quit Excel
objExcel.Quit

MsgBox “Excel workbook created and saved to ” & strSavePath

‘ Clean up objects
Set objSheet = Nothing
Set objWorkbook = Nothing
Set objExcel = Nothing

Important Notes for VBScript and Excel: The Golden Rule: Flexibility is Your Best Friend

  • Security Warnings: When an external script tries to control Office applications, you might encounter security warnings, especially if the script tries to open or save files from untrusted locations. Ensure your Office security settings allow external automation or trust the locations where your scripts and files reside.
  • Error Handling: Real-world scripts need robust error handling On Error Resume Next, On Error GoTo 0 to manage situations where Excel might not open, a file is missing, or an operation fails.
  • Compatibility: This approach relies on the Component Object Model COM, which is a core Windows technology that allows different applications to talk to each other. It’s generally stable but can be sensitive to different versions of Office.

Commenting in VBScript: Keeping Your Code Readable

Just like with any programming language, adding comments to your VBScript code is super important. They help you and anyone else looking at your code understand what each part does, why it’s there, and any specific logic behind it. This is especially true if you come back to a script months or years later!

VBScript offers a couple of ways to add comments:

  1. Single Quote ': This is the most common way. Any text on a line that comes after a single quote is treated as a comment and is ignored by the VBScript interpreter.

    ‘ This is a full-line comment. It explains the purpose of the script.
    Dim myVariable ‘ This is an inline comment explaining myVariable. How to Snag the Cheapest Flight Tickets from India to Any Country

  2. Rem Keyword: Short for “Remark,” the Rem keyword also denotes a comment. It’s a bit older and less commonly used today, but you’ll see it in legacy scripts. If Rem follows another statement on the same line, you need to separate them with a colon :.

    Rem This is another full-line comment.
    Dim myOtherVariable : Rem This is an inline comment using Rem.
    Most people just stick with the single quote because it’s less fussy and doesn’t require the colon.

No Block Comments: One thing to note is that VBScript doesn’t have a native way to do “block comments” where you can comment out multiple lines with a single start and end marker, like /* ... */ in some other languages. If you want to comment out several lines, you’ll need to put a ' or Rem at the beginning of each line.

What is Virtualization-Based Security VBS?

VBS is a security technology that uses hardware virtualization features like Intel VT-x or AMD-V in your CPU and the Windows Hypervisor to create an isolated, secure environment within your operating system. Think of it like a protective bubble that runs separately from the main Windows kernel.

Windows then uses this isolated environment to host critical security components, such as Memory Integrity also known as Hypervisor-Protected Code Integrity, or HVCI. Memory Integrity ensures that only trusted, digitally signed drivers and system files can run in your PC’s memory, making it incredibly difficult for malicious software malware to inject harmful code or exploit vulnerabilities in the operating system’s core.

Essentially, VBS adds a robust layer of defense against sophisticated attacks, even if malware manages to gain access to the OS kernel. It’s a fantastic feature for enhancing your PC’s security.

Why Do People Disable VBS? Performance Concerns

So, if VBS is so good for security, why would anyone want to disable it? The main reason often boils down to performance. Because VBS creates and maintains this isolated virtual environment, it uses some system resources, which can sometimes lead to a slight decrease in performance, especially in demanding applications like video games.

While for most everyday use, the performance impact is negligible, some gamers or users running performance-critical applications might notice a difference and choose to disable VBS to squeeze out every bit of speed from their system. Some sources suggest a potential performance hit of 5% to 15% in certain scenarios. How to Snag the Cheapest Round-Trip Flight Tickets from Cameroon to Dubai

How to Check if VBS is Enabled

Before you try to disable something, it’s a good idea to check if it’s even running!

  1. Open System Information: Press Windows Key + R, type msinfo32, and press Enter.
  2. In the System Information window, look for the entry “Virtualization-based security.”
    • If it says “Running,” VBS is enabled.
    • If it says “Not enabled,” then it’s off.

How to Disable Virtualization-Based Security VBS in Windows 11/10

If you’ve decided the potential performance boost outweighs the security benefits and understand the risks, here’s how you can typically disable VBS. It’s often a multi-step process, as different components contribute to its activation.

Important Warning: Disabling VBS will reduce your system’s overall security and make it more vulnerable to certain advanced types of malware. Proceed with caution and ensure you have other robust security measures in place, like a good antivirus.

Here are a few methods you can try:

Method 1: Through Windows Security Core Isolation

This is usually the first place to check, as it controls Memory Integrity, a key part of VBS. Finding the Absolute Cheapest Air Ticket from Vancouver to Delhi

  1. Open Windows Security: Go to Start > Settings > Privacy & security Windows 11 or Update & Security Windows 10 > Windows Security.
  2. Click on Device security.
  3. Under the “Core isolation” section, click on Core isolation details.
  4. Toggle the switch for “Memory integrity” to Off.
  5. You’ll likely be prompted to restart your computer. Do so to apply the changes.

Note: Disabling Memory Integrity alone might not fully disable VBS. You might need to combine this with other methods.

Method 2: Via Windows Features

VBS relies on certain Windows features, such as the Virtual Machine Platform. Disabling these can also turn off VBS.

  1. Open “Turn Windows features on or off”: Search for “Windows features” in the Start menu and select the relevant option.
  2. In the “Windows Features” dialog box, scroll down and uncheck the following options if they are checked:
    • Microsoft Defender Application Guard if present
    • Virtual Machine Platform
    • Windows Hypervisor Platform
  3. Click OK and then restart your PC when prompted.

Method 3: Using the Registry Editor

This method involves making changes directly in the Windows Registry. Be extremely careful when editing the Registry, as incorrect changes can cause system instability.

  1. Open Registry Editor: Press Windows Key + R, type regedit, and press Enter. Click Yes if prompted by User Account Control.
  2. Navigate to the following path:
    H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Control\DeviceGuard
  3. In the right pane, look for a DWORD value named EnableVirtualizationBasedSecurity.
    * If it exists, double-click it and set its Value data to 0 zero.
    * If it doesn’t exist, right-click in the empty space, select New > DWORD 32-bit Value, name it EnableVirtualizationBasedSecurity, and then set its value to 0.
  4. Close Registry Editor and restart your computer.

Method 4: Through Group Policy Editor Windows Pro/Enterprise

If you’re using Windows Pro, Enterprise, or Education editions, you can use the Group Policy Editor. Home editions don’t have this by default.

  1. Open Group Policy Editor: Press Windows Key + R, type gpedit.msc, and press Enter.
  2. Navigate to: Local Computer Policy > Computer Configuration > Administrative Templates > System > Device Guard.
  3. In the right pane, double-click on “Turn on Virtualization Based Security.”
  4. Select the “Disabled” option.
  5. Click Apply, then OK, and restart your PC.

Method 5: Disabling Hypervisor Launch Type via Command Prompt

This method directly affects how the Windows Hypervisor starts. Ultimate Guide to Vancouver to Istanbul Flights: Your Journey Across Continents

  1. Open Command Prompt as Administrator: Search for “Command Prompt,” right-click it, and select “Run as administrator.”
  2. Type the following command and press Enter:
    bcdedit /set hypervisorlaunchtype off
  3. Restart your computer.

Method 6: In Your PC’s BIOS/UEFI Settings

Sometimes, VBS can be enabled or influenced by virtualization settings directly in your computer’s firmware. This is often labeled as Intel VT-x, Intel Virtualization Technology, AMD-V, or SVM Mode.

  1. Restart your PC and enter BIOS/UEFI: This usually involves pressing a key like Delete, F2, F10, or F12 repeatedly during startup. The exact key varies by manufacturer.
  2. Navigate to sections like Advanced, CPU Configuration, Security, or Virtualization.
  3. Look for an option related to “Virtualization Technology,” “Intel VT-x,” “AMD-V,” or “SVM Mode” and set it to Disabled.
  4. Save your changes often F10 and exit the BIOS/UEFI. Your PC will restart.

Note: Disabling virtualization in BIOS will prevent all virtualization features from working, including running virtual machines like Hyper-V, VMware, or VirtualBox or Windows Subsystem for Linux WSL.

After trying any of these methods, it’s a good idea to re-check the “Virtualization-based security” status in msinfo32 to confirm it’s “Not enabled.”

How to Enable Virtualization-Based Security VBS

If you’ve disabled VBS and want to re-enable it which is generally recommended for optimal security, you’ll essentially reverse the steps above.

  • Windows Security: Turn “Memory integrity” back On.
  • Windows Features: Re-check Virtual Machine Platform, Windows Hypervisor Platform, etc.
  • Registry Editor: Set EnableVirtualizationBasedSecurity back to 1.
  • Group Policy Editor: Set “Turn on Virtualization Based Security” back to Enabled.
  • Command Prompt: Use bcdedit /set hypervisorlaunchtype auto to enable.
  • BIOS/UEFI: Re-enable Intel VT-x, AMD-V, or SVM Mode.

Remember to restart your PC after making changes.

Risks of Disabling VBS

While disabling VBS might give you a marginal performance boost in specific scenarios, it’s crucial to understand that it significantly lowers your system’s defense against advanced threats. Without VBS, your kernel and crucial security assets like user credentials are more vulnerable to attacks, including those that might try to bypass your antivirus software. For most users, the enhanced security provided by VBS and Memory Integrity is well worth any minor performance overhead.

Security Considerations for VBScript

Since VBScript files are essentially executable code, they can be used for both good and bad. While they can automate helpful tasks, they can also be exploited to distribute malware, delete files, or steal information.

Always be cautious:

  • Don’t open unknown .vbs files: Never double-click a VBScript file that you’ve downloaded from an untrusted source or received as an email attachment unless you are absolutely sure of its origin and purpose.
  • Inspect the code: If you’re unsure, open the .vbs file with Notepad right-click > Edit or Open with > Notepad and look at the code. While it might look confusing, you can often spot suspicious commands like anything trying to delete large numbers of files, download executables, or send data.
  • Run in a sandbox/virtual machine: If you must test an untrusted VBScript, do it in an isolated environment like a virtual machine that can be easily reset, not on your main PC.

Limitations and Alternatives to VBScript

As mentioned earlier, VBScript is a deprecated language, which means it’s not going to see new features or extensive support from Microsoft. Its use in web development is practically non-existent outside of very old Internet Explorer-dependent applications.

While it still has niche uses for Windows task automation, especially in legacy systems, for new projects, you should definitely look at more modern and powerful alternatives:

  • PowerShell: This is Microsoft’s go-to scripting language for Windows administration and automation. It’s built on .NET, offers much more robust functionality, better error handling, and extensive cmdlets commands for managing every aspect of Windows and even cloud services.
  • Python: A general-purpose programming language that’s incredibly popular for scripting, data analysis, web development, and automation across all operating systems. It has a huge ecosystem of libraries and a very readable syntax.
  • JavaScript Node.js: While JavaScript started in web browsers, Node.js allows you to run JavaScript on the server or as a standalone scripting language for desktop automation, offering cross-platform capabilities.
  • AutoHotkey / AutoIt: These are fantastic scripting languages specifically designed for Windows automation, macro creation, and GUI manipulation. They’re often easier for simple tasks than PowerShell or Python.

If you’re looking to automate tasks on your Windows machine, especially in a professional or modern context, learning PowerShell or Python would be a much better investment of your time than VBScript.

Frequently Asked Questions

What is a VBS file?

A VBS file is a plain text file containing code written in VBScript Visual Basic Scripting Edition. It’s essentially a small program that can be executed on Microsoft Windows to automate tasks, interact with applications, or perform system administration functions.

How do I run a VBS file?

You can run a VBS file by simply double-clicking it in File Explorer. For more control, especially for scripts with text output, you can open Command Prompt or PowerShell, navigate to the script’s directory, and run it using cscript YourScript.vbs.

What’s the difference between wscript and cscript?

WScript.exe Windows Script Host is the default graphical interpreter for VBScripts, typically used when you double-click a .vbs file. It displays output in message boxes. CScript.exe Command-line Script Host is the console-based interpreter, used when running scripts from Command Prompt or PowerShell, and it prints output directly to the console window.

Can I use VBScript in Excel?

Yes, VBScript can interact with Excel, but it does so externally, by creating an instance of the Excel application through the Component Object Model COM. This is different from VBA Visual Basic for Applications, which is the native programming language built directly into Excel workbooks for macros. You write VBScript in a .vbs file, and that file then manipulates Excel.

How do I comment out lines in VBScript?

You can comment out a single line in VBScript by starting the line with a single apostrophe '. You can also use the Rem keyword. VBScript does not natively support multi-line block comments, so you need to add a comment marker to each line you wish to comment out.

What is Virtualization-Based Security VBS in Windows, and how is it different from VBScript?

Virtualization-Based Security VBS is a Windows 10/11 security feature that uses hardware virtualization to create an isolated environment to protect critical system components like Memory Integrity. It’s a modern security defense. VBScript is an older programming language used for scripting and automation. They are completely different technologies, despite sharing the “VBS” acronym.

Should I disable VBS Virtualization-Based Security to improve performance?

While disabling Virtualization-Based Security VBS might offer a marginal performance improvement in some demanding applications like certain games, it significantly reduces your system’s security against advanced threats. For most users, the security benefits of VBS outweigh the minor performance overhead, so it’s generally recommended to keep it enabled.

What are modern alternatives to VBScript?

For Windows automation and scripting, popular and more powerful alternatives to VBScript include PowerShell and Python. For web development, JavaScript especially with Node.js is the industry standard. Tools like AutoHotkey or AutoIt are also great for specific Windows automation and macro creation tasks.
